Bankruptcy Certificate Services
If you are filing bankruptcy, federal law requires approved education at two points in the process. Money Fit provides both required certificates through secure, online courses, with access to certified counselors when needed.

Choose the course you need
Pre-Filing Credit Counseling
Required before you file bankruptcy. This course reviews your financial situation and explains alternatives before you proceed.
Post-Filing Debtor Education
Required after you file bankruptcy. This course focuses on financial management and is needed before your case can be discharged.

What this service is and is not
These courses satisfy federal bankruptcy education requirements. They are educational in nature and do not provide legal advice or representation. For legal questions, consult a qualified bankruptcy attorney.
